Transaction 87df5e205495ea0de1628060694a786d90ec7f85b2a617b474adc8c639b8da1e
1 Input
1 Output
-
87df5e205495ea0de1628060694a786d90ec7f85b2a617b474adc8c639b8da1e:0
- value
- 3685294
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b70aeec4ec8e848a54be79458bb36ee4cbe73602dc8ed11a580cafdb6b059657
- address
- bc1pku9wa38v36zg549709zchvmwun97wdszmj8dzxjcpjhak6c9jetshs3334